Veeam Backup & Replication stands out for combining fast, application-aware backup with built-in replication workflows. It delivers continuous protection through replication options that support planned or automated recovery objectives for virtual and physical workloads. Its orchestration and granular restore tooling focus on meeting RTO and RPO targets during ransomware-style recovery scenarios. Integration with VMware, Hyper-V, and common backup storage types helps teams run consistent backup and replication at scale.

Microsoft Azure Backup stands out with integrated recovery for Azure resources and hybrid workloads, including Windows and Linux servers. It supports backup policies with schedule and retention, and it can move recovery data into Azure for centralized protection. For replication-style recovery, it emphasizes restore points and cross-region restore options rather than continuous data replication. It fits backup administrators managing Azure-native and on-premises environments under one console experience.

What Is Backup Replication Software?
Backup replication software moves protected data from one place to another so disaster recovery and recovery testing can run with controlled restore workflows. It typically combines backup orchestration with replication-style workflows that support failover tests, planned recovery, and governance of immutable or recovery-ready restore points. Tools like Veeam Backup & Replication pair application-aware backups for VMware and Hyper-V with replication planning and granular restore automation. Platform suites like Commvault and Rubrik add policy-driven protection and analytics to manage backup posture and restore readiness across many workloads.

Common Mistakes to Avoid
Common failures in backup replication projects come from skipping recovery verification, underestimating replication design effort, or choosing a replication approach that does not match the tested restore path.
Building replication without proving recoverability through testing
Tools that emphasize testing reduce this risk, and Veeam Backup & Replication uses SureBackup for automated recovery verification with isolated failover testing. Unitrends also validates backup usability through restore testing before recovered systems are relied on.
Assuming replication is continuous when the platform is restore-point based
Microsoft Azure Backup is restore-point based and emphasizes restore points and cross-region restore options rather than continuous workload replication. AWS Elastic Disaster Recovery focuses on AWS-managed recovery planning and recovery execution rather than building continuous replication for every workload.
Ignoring multi-site tuning and resource planning during design
Advanced replication configuration can become complex and resource planning needs careful sizing in multi-site designs for Veeam Backup & Replication, Commvault, Rubrik, and Acronis Cyber Protect. These products can require dedicated tuning for reporting and monitoring depth in large environments.
Overlooking granular restore needs and forcing full restores during incidents
When teams require quick file and item recovery, Nakivo Backup & Replication provides searchable recovery that avoids restoring entire systems. Veeam Backup & Replication also supports granular file, VM, and item-level recovery operations for faster incident response.
